LUCENA CITY — The Philippine Coast Guard (PCG) has suspended operations of small vessels in northern Quezon province due to rough seas starting Sunday afternoon, Jan. 11. In advisories issued Sunday and Monday, the PCG station in northern Quezon, based in Real, cited a weather bulletin from the Philippine Atmospheric, Geophysical and Astronomical Services Administration. The bulletin warned that strong to gale-force winds from the northeast monsoon are affecting or expected to affect coastal areas of General Nakar.
